European Chamber Nanjing Chapter Board Election:
The Nanjing Board Election where the Chair of the Nanjing Board (1), Vice Chair (1) and Nanjing Board positions (3) are elected, will take place on the 22nd April.
Who can run for election?
1. Chair (1 position) – Any representative of a corporate member of the European Chamber
2. Vice Chair (1 position) - Any representative of a corporate member of the European Chamber
3. Board Member (3 positions)– Any representative of a corporate member of the European Chamber or any individual member
Who can vote?
You can vote in the election if you:
1.a Are a designated representative (the main contact between the European Chamber and your company), or
1.b Are an individual member
and
2. Paid the membership fee for 2019 (please make sure that the Chamber has received and confirmed your membership payment by no later than the 30th of March 2019.)
How can I vote?
You are welcome to cast your vote either in person or by designating a proxy to vote on your behalf.
1)You can vote in person by secret ballot at the election venue. Please note that even if you have voting rights confirmed by the Secretariat of the Chamber, you must have registered for the Board Election in order to exercise this vote.
2) Assign a proxy to vote on your behalf by 15th April 2019 noon. Please fill in the proxy Form and send a scanned copy to HaiyanYou at hyyou@europeanchamber.com.cn or in person at the Chamber office in Nanjing (Room 13A07, 14/F, No. 99 Zhongshan Road, Gulou District, Nanjing).
The proxy must be a colleague from your own legal entity and must be present to vote. This requirement has only one exception for the Individual member, who may give his/her proxy to another individual member/corporate member in Nanjing Chapter.
Proxies received after the deadline and in a format different from those listed above will not be accepted.
How can I run for election?
The nomination period is open from now until the 15th of April, 2019, 2 pm.
If you would like to run for the Nanjing Board Chair, Vice Chair, or Board member, you need to:
1) Be nominated by two designated representatives of other members eligible to vote (please refer to the above section “who can vote and run for elections?”)
2) Fill in and sign the Nomination Form. The nomination form must also be signed by both the proposer and the seconder, who must be members of the sectoral working groups in good standing (with paid dues).
3) Send the nomination form scanned by e-mail to Haiyan You at (hyyou@europeanchamber.com.cn) or in person at the Chamber office in Nanjing by the 15th of April, 2019, 2 pm.
4) Provide a short bio and letter of motivation scanned by e-mail to Haiyan You at (hyyou@europeanchamber.com.cn) or in person at the Chamber office in Nanjing by the 15th of April, 2019, 2 pm.
